SaLT – Speech and Language Tools for Early Intervention for Teachers
We are proud to be partners in another exciting Erasmus+ project called SaLT (Speech and Language Tools for Early Intervention for Teachers). The aim of this project is to create early intervention tools to support teachers to help students in early language learning.
Learning a language is a life-long process that begins in the first months of life and continues throughout the years of maturity. Learning processes develop in early childhood at their fastest speed. Language acquisition and communication are essential for the success of children in early years education and school. Communication is a complex human skill that combines physical and mental elements, and it is crucial for all children. Modern society requires a high level of communication skills; speech, language, vision and literacy are fundamental skills needed to meet these requirements. This project aims to help teachers identify language and communication difficulties in children and provide tools to support them.
Concrete objectives of the SaLT project
The concrete objectives of the project are:
- To improve teachers’ understanding of innovative approaches and methods used to address the needs and interests of students with speech and language problems.
- To boost understanding of teachers regarding the legal regulations on speech and language support at early childhood education.
- To increase motivation among teachers for native language acquisition processes, innovative teaching methods and digital tools used in the intervention in the case of speech and language problems.
- To improve the level of knowledge of good practices about speech and language support systems in the partner countries and around Europe.
- To increase knowledge on speech and language assessment, early intervention and practices in teachers.
- To improve the speech and language performance of the students who have some difficulties through innovative methods and tools.
- To boost the confidence of teachers and pedagogical staff in working with students who have speech & language disorders such as articulation, voice, fluency, expression etc.
- To improve strategic use of ICT and digital skills of teachers through the mobile app with an educative support plan.
- To increase the attention of target groups and beneficiaries to use project results
- To improve understanding of speech & language support at early childhood age.
- To increase the motivation of target groups to use and apply the innovative methods and tools used in intervention for speech and language problems.
- To boost knowledge of the target groups with summarized comparative report analysis through the policy report.
- To develop an understanding of the project results by wider impact to reach out to academics, policymakers, pedagogical staff and parents around Europe.
Kildare Town ET NS are delighted to be involved in this project with partners from Romania, Greece, Spain, France and Austria.
